"Following a comfortable win over Real Oviedo in La Liga at the weekend, Barcelona return to action for the most consequential game of their season so far as the Blaugrana welcome Danish champions FC Copenhagen to Camp Nou for their final match in the league phase of this season's Champions League on Wednesday night. All 18 matches in the league phase finale will kick off at the same time in what promises to be a wild night of action,"
"As far as Barça are concerned, they come into the last night of the league phase with a simple task: finish in the Top 8. Barcelona sit ninth with 13 points and must finish in the Top 8 to secure an automatic place in the Champions League Round of 16. FC Copenhagen occupy 26th with eight points and visit Camp Nou for the final league phase match on January 28, 2026. Barcelona list Gavi, Pedri and Andreas Christensen as doubts while Frenkie de Jong is out. Copenhagen have Magnus Mattsson doubtful and Thomas Delaney out. All league phase finales kick off simultaneously. Broadcast options include Paramount+, discovery+, Sony LIV and Movistar+ across various markets.
